the whiteline front strut brace just fits. it bends behind the throttle body. it just touches that thingy that comes out of the back of the throttle body, and rattled a bit, but a bit of foam pipe insulation around the brace cured that.

http://ca.msnusers.com/99mini/shoebox.msnw?action=ShowPhoto&PhotoID=134

(this is a tibby engine/tranny combo which sits a bit higher than a tibby engine/accent tranny combo.)
